Title: The Influence of Expectancy-disconfirmation Paradigm on Revisit Intention among Water Leisure Sport Participants
Abstract: The purpose of this study was to apply of Expectancy-Performance Disconfirmation in relationships among water leisure sport expectation before participation, performance after participation, disconfimation and revisit intention.BR For this research, questionnaires were distributed to water leisure sport participants in Seoul & Gyeonggi-do from Jun, 2014 to Aug, 2014. Convenience sampling 215 samples obtained from method were used in order to analyze the effects. The results of this study were as follows;BR First, Expectation factor and Performance factor of water leisure sport have statistically significant difference. Second, Expectation factor of water leisure sport has a positive effect on expectancy-performance disconfirmation. But only three factors, program, price and staff have a positive effect on expectancy-performance disconfirmation. Third, Performance factor of water leisure sport has a positive effect on expectancy-performance disconfirmation. But only three factors, program, price and staff have a positive effect on expectancy-performance disconfirmation. Forth, expectancy-performance disconfirmation have a positive effect on revisit intention.
